Output 96291d807a29af0d3c237cfa40a646ee398dda4f6061799d17f3762a525f7ada:1

value
2564820000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b87093086d786a184067545dad5fe282c9beb95f OP_EQUALVERIFY OP_CHECKSIG
address
1HpEC6myWPZ367CWGfMTcwSvjFUHwf7i6c
transaction
96291d807a29af0d3c237cfa40a646ee398dda4f6061799d17f3762a525f7ada
spent
true